Abstract

Hepatocellular carcinoma (HCC) is considered as a challenging problematic issue among various types of carcinomas. Mechanisms of HCC progression varies including hepatitis, alcohol, non-alcoholic fatty liver diseases, genetic and epigenetics. The current search for exact molecular mechanism to develop HCC is still not fully achievable. Thus, our study put an emphasis on two genes that are involved in the miRNA biogenesis machinery genes (XPO5 and RAN). As we hypothesized that any aberration in those genes will cause crucial impact on miRNAs nuclear export and subsequent regulatory effects on whole genome expression including carcinogenic phenotype. One of the variants of two genes is XPO5*rs34324335 which represents missense located in p.Ser241Asn of the XPO5 protein in addition, the second locus RAN*rs14035 that represents 3′ UTR region on RAN gene, Fig.36.
